IT 기술 문서


2025.02.20 20:00

윈도우 RDP , 원격 접속을 위한 네트워크 및 방화벽 설정

  • it33 22일 전 2025.02.20 20:00
  • 14
    0

alt text


원격 접속이 정상적으로 작동하도록 방화벽 설정, 포트 포워딩, 공인 IP 활용 방법을 설명합니다.


1. Windows 방화벽에서 원격 접속 허용

윈도우 10은 기본적으로 보안을 위해 원격 데스크톱(RDP) 연결을 차단하고 있습니다.

따라서 원격 접속이 가능하도록 방화벽에서 허용해야 합니다.

1-1. 방화벽 설정 변경 방법

  1. Windows 검색 창에서 "Windows Defender 방화벽"을 검색하여 실행합니다.

  2. 좌측 메뉴에서 "고급 설정"을 클릭합니다.

  3. "인바운드 규칙"을 선택한 후 우측에서 "새 규칙"을 클릭합니다.

  4. 규칙 유형에서 "포트"를 선택하고 "다음"을 클릭합니다.

  5. "TCP"를 선택하고 특정 로컬 포트에 "3389"를 입력한 후 "다음"을 클릭합니다.

  6. "연결 허용"을 선택한 후 "다음"을 클릭합니다.

  7. 프로필에서 "도메인", "개인", "공용"을 모두 선택한 후 "다음"을 클릭합니다.

  8. 규칙 이름을 "원격 데스크톱(RDP)"로 입력한 후 "마침"을 클릭합니다.

설정을 완료한 후 방화벽이 원격 접속을 차단하지 않는지 확인해야 합니다.


2. 공유기(라우터)에서 포트 포워딩 설정

공유기를 사용하는 경우, 외부에서 원격 데스크톱에 접속하려면 포트 포워딩 설정이 필요합니다.

2-1. 포트 포워딩이란?

공유기는 여러 기기가 하나의 인터넷을 사용할 수 있도록 합니다.

이때 외부에서 특정 컴퓨터로 접속하려면 공유기에 접속 요청을 특정 PC로 전달하는 포트 포워딩 설정이 필요합니다.

2-2. 공유기에서 포트 포워딩 설정하는 방법

  1. 인터넷 브라우저를 열고 공유기 설정 페이지에 접속합니다.

    • 대부분의 공유기는 192.168.0.1 또는 192.168.1.1에서 설정할 수 있습니다.

    • 정확한 주소는 공유기 제조사의 설명서를 확인해야 합니다.

  2. 관리자 계정으로 로그인합니다.

    • 기본 로그인 정보는 공유기 하단의 라벨이나 매뉴얼에 나와 있습니다.

  3. 포트 포워딩(포트 매핑) 메뉴를 찾습니다.

    • 공유기 설정에서 "포트 포워딩" 또는 "포트 매핑"을 찾아 이동합니다.

  4. 포트 포워딩 규칙을 추가합니다.

    • 서비스 이름: 원격 데스크톱(RDP)

    • 외부 포트: 3389

    • 내부 IP 주소: 원격 접속할 컴퓨터의 내부 IP 주소 (예: 192.168.1.10)

    • 내부 포트: 3389

    • 프로토콜: TCP

  5. 저장한 후 공유기를 재부팅합니다.

포트 포워딩이 정상적으로 설정되었는지 확인하려면 외부 네트워크에서 원격 접속을 시도해야 합니다.


3. 공인 IP 확인 및 DDNS 설정

원격 접속을 위해서는 공인 IP를 알아야 합니다.

공인 IP는 인터넷 서비스 제공업체(ISP)에서 부여하는 외부 네트워크 주소이며, 이를 통해 외부에서 내부 네트워크로 접속할 수 있습니다.

3-1. 공인 IP 확인 방법

  1. 브라우저를 열고 "내 IP 확인"을 검색합니다.

  2. IP 확인 사이트에서 현재 공인 IP를 확인합니다.

  3. 이 IP 주소를 사용하여 원격 접속을 시도할 수 있습니다.

3-2. 공인 IP가 변경될 경우 해결 방법

일반적으로 가정용 인터넷의 공인 IP 주소는 주기적으로 변경됩니다.

따라서 IP가 바뀌어도 원격 접속을 유지하려면 DDNS(Dynamic DNS) 서비스를 사용해야 합니다.

3-3. DDNS 설정 방법

DDNS를 설정하면 고정된 도메인 주소를 사용하여 원격 접속이 가능합니다.

  1. DDNS 제공 사이트 가입

  2. DDNS 서비스에서 도메인 등록

    • 예: myremote.ddns.net

  3. 공유기 DDNS 설정

    • 공유기 관리 페이지에서 DDNS 설정을 찾습니다.

    • 제공업체(No-IP, DuckDNS 등)를 선택합니다.

    • 등록한 도메인 주소와 계정 정보를 입력한 후 저장합니다.

  4. 설정이 완료되면 myremote.ddns.net을 사용하여 원격 접속이 가능합니다.


4. 원격 접속 테스트 및 확인

위 설정을 완료한 후 외부 네트워크에서 원격 접속이 정상적으로 되는지 확인해야 합니다.

4-1. 외부 네트워크에서 원격 접속 테스트

  1. 원격 접속할 PC에서 인터넷 연결이 정상적인지 확인합니다.

  2. 다른 네트워크 환경(예: 모바일 핫스팟)을 이용하여 인터넷에 접속합니다.

  3. Windows 키 + R을 누른 후 mstsc를 입력하고 실행합니다.

  4. "컴퓨터" 칸에 공인 IP 또는 DDNS 도메인 주소를 입력합니다.

  5. "연결"을 클릭합니다.

  6. 사용자 계정과 비밀번호를 입력한 후 접속이 정상적으로 이루어지는지 확인합니다.

4-2. 포트 포워딩 및 방화벽 문제 해결

원격 접속이 정상적으로 되지 않을 경우 다음 항목을 확인해야 합니다.

문제

해결 방법

"원격 데스크톱을 사용할 수 없음" 오류

원격 데스크톱 설정이 활성화되었는지 확인

"연결할 수 없음" 오류

방화벽 설정에서 RDP 포트(3389)가 열려 있는지 확인

"네트워크 오류" 발생

공유기 포트 포워딩이 정상적으로 설정되었는지 확인

"IP 주소가 변경됨"

공인 IP 변경 여부 확인 후 DDNS 사용 검토

"비밀번호가 틀림"

사용자 계정 비밀번호 확인 후 다시 입력

설정이 정상적으로 완료되었다면, 원격 데스크톱 연결이 가능해야 합니다.


2단계 마무리

  • 방화벽에서 원격 접속 포트(3389)를 허용함

  • 공유기에서 포트 포워딩을 설정하여 외부 접속 가능하도록 구성함

  • 공인 IP를 확인하고 DDNS를 설정하여 IP 변경 문제 해결

  • 외부 네트워크에서 원격 접속을 테스트하여 정상 작동 여부 확인

  • 공유링크 복사